The Thomas Walkup Saga: Olympiakos Faces Dubai Shock and EuroLeague Investigation

As the EuroLeague season approaches, Olympiakos has unexpectedly plunged into an unprecedented internal crisis. Thomas Walkup, the 32-year-old point guard considered the soul of the Greek club's play, has officially requested a release from his contract and refused to attend the pre-season training camp. Behind this shocking decision lies the interest from a wealthy Dubai club, a new financial power testing the boundaries of European basketball. EuroLeague immediately stepped in, launching an investigation into a potential violation of transfer regulations, turning this from a mere contract dispute into a landmark case for the entire league.
Walkup is not a flashy scorer, but his value lies in his ability to orchestrate, command the offense, and his relentless fighting spirit. At 32, he is in the final stage of his prime, but his basketball IQ and playmaking ability remain invaluable assets. His departure would leave a huge void in the Olympiakos roster, a team that always aims for the Final Four. His boycott of the training camp is not just a signal of a fractured relationship with the management, but also a heavy blow to the team's morale.
The EuroLeague investigation focuses on whether the Dubai club violated regulations by approaching a player still under contract. This is a complex legal issue involving multiple bodies: EuroLeague, FIBA, and potentially the FIBA Basketball Arbitral Tribunal (BAT). If Walkup wants to leave, he needs a clean letter of release from Olympiakos, which the Greek club will certainly not hand over easily. Conversely, if Walkup can prove Olympiakos breached his contract, he could be granted free agency by the BAT. The case promises to set an important precedent for how EuroLeague handles overtures from clubs outside the league, especially from the wealthy Gulf region.
Notably, the reaction from EuroLeague is significant. The league's proactive information gathering shows they view this as a potential threat to order and fair competition. If the Dubai club succeeds in recruiting Walkup, it would signal that the financial power of Middle Eastern teams could drain talent from European powerhouses, altering the balance of power. This is not just a story about one player, but a story about the future of European basketball facing a wave of new investment.
For Olympiakos, they face a difficult puzzle. Keeping a player who doesn't want to stay could poison the locker room. Releasing him means finding a high-quality replacement, which is not easy mid-season. Head coach Georgios Bartzokas and the management need to act quickly and wisely to minimize the damage. They could choose to discipline Walkup to set an example, or seek a compensation settlement to avoid a lengthy and costly legal battle at the BAT.
This case also raises questions about the role of agents and their strategies. The Dubai club's admission of interest could be a lever to pressure Olympiakos into negotiations. However, if the saga drags on, it could damage the image of all three parties: the player, the parent club, and the club seeking his services. In European basketball, where relationships and reputations are paramount, such a scandal can leave lasting scars.
Looking ahead, the Walkup case is a test of EuroLeague's governance capabilities. Will they be strong enough to protect their regulations against the immense financial pressure from outside? Or will they have to concede and accept a new reality where money can buy everything, including the stability of the league? The answer will come in the coming weeks when the investigation concludes. But one thing is certain: Olympiakos's season has been severely impacted before it even began, and they need to find a quick solution to salvage their goals.
